With 3.11, this patch series and CONFIG_TRANSPARENT_HUGEPAGE_ALWAYS, I
consistently hit the same failure when exiting one of my stress-testers
[1] when using eg 24 cores.

Doesn't happen with 8 cores, so likely needs enough virtual memory to
use multiple split locks. Otherwise, this is very promising work!
